FAQ OF HITACHI LYA250A
1.Can I use the LYA250A for DC circuits? |
MCCBs are primarily designed for AC circuits. While some MCCBs have specific DC ratings, you must check the datasheet for the exact LYA250A model to see if it has a rated DC voltage and breaking capacity. |
2. What does "250A" in LYA250A signify? |
The "250A" typically refers to the frame size of the circuit breaker. This indicates the maximum continuous current rating that the physical housing and internal components are designed to handle. |
3. Can the LYA250A be reset after it trips? |
Yes, after the fault condition (overload or short circuit) has been cleared, the LYA250A can typically be reset manually by moving its handle fully to the OFF position (if it's not already there) and then to the ON position. |
